Indian
saxophonist
and
pioneer
of
Carnatic
music
Kadri
Gopalnath
passed
away
today,
aged
69.
Cardiac
arrest
is
stated
as
the
reason
for
the
demise
of
the
noted
musician.
He
was
admitted
to
A.J.
Hospital
and
Research
Center
in
Bangalore
on
October
10,
after
he
complained
of
backache.
He
took
his
last
breath
today
at
4.45
am.
Gopalnath
is
survived
by
wife
Sarojini
and
two
sons.
According
to
close
sources,
the
family
is
waiting
for
his
elder
son
Guruprasad,
who
resides
in
Kuwait,
to
conduct
the
final
rites.
Gopalnath's
body
will
be
placed
for
display
in
Town
Hall,
for
the
public
to
pay
their
last
respects.
Prime
Minister
of
India
Narendra
Modi
paid
his
condolences
to
Gopalnath
by
tweeting,
"The
remarkable
Kadri
Gopalnath
epitomised
excellence.
Blessed
with
exceptional
diligence
and
talent,
he
made
a
valuable
contribution
to
Carnatic
music.
His
works
were
popular
across
continents.
Pained
by
his
demise.
My
thoughts
are
with
his
family
and
admirers:
PM
@narendramodi."
